106 providers in Blood Banking And Transfusion Medicine, Infectious Diseases, Pediatric Cardiovascular Surgery, Pediatric Lung Disease (pulmonary)

106 providers in Blood Banking And Transfusion Medicine, Infectious Diseases, Pediatric Cardiovascular Surgery, Pediatric Lung Disease (pulmonary)